Class OutpostClaimStakeItem
A claim stake allows claiming plots contiguous with the stake. This version is for non-settlement usages.
Inheritance
System.Object
OutpostClaimStakeItem
Implements
System.ComponentModel.INotifyPropertyChanged
Inherited Members
Namespace: Eco.Gameplay.Settlements.ClaimStakes
Assembly: Eco.Gameplay.dll
Syntax
public class OutpostClaimStakeItem : ClaimStakeItemBase, IItem, ILinkableParameterized<LinkConfig>, ILinkable, IHasIcon, INotifyPropertyChanged, IPlaceableItem, IController, IViewController, IHasUniversalID
Constructors
OutpostClaimStakeItem()
Declaration
public OutpostClaimStakeItem()
Properties
WorldObjectType
Declaration
public override Type WorldObjectType { get; }
Property Value
Type | Description |
---|---|
System.Type |
Overrides
Methods
DeedName(User)
Declaration
protected override LocString DeedName(User user)
Parameters
Type | Name | Description |
---|---|---|
User | user |
Returns
Type | Description |
---|---|
LocString |
Overrides
OnSelected(Player)
Declaration
public override void OnSelected(Player player)
Parameters
Type | Name | Description |
---|---|---|
Player | player |
Overrides
Implements
System.ComponentModel.INotifyPropertyChanged